Was Syria colonized by France?

France established the states of Damascus and Aleppo, together with the autonomous Alawite territory, throughout the French Mandate of Syria on December 1, 1920. The League of Nations (LoN) Council formally accepted the French Mandate of Syria on July 24, 1922.

Is Syria near Lebanon?

The Lebanon–Syria border is 394 km (245 m) in size and runs from the Mediterranean coast within the north to the tripoint with Israel within the south.

What did Syria do in ww2?

The Syria–Lebanon marketing campaign, also called Operation Exporter, was the British invasion of Vichy French Syria and Lebanon from June–July 1941, throughout the Second World Struggle. The French had ceded autonomy to Syria in September 1936, with the precise to keep up armed forces and two airfields within the territory.

Why was Lebanon separated from Syria?

To guard its energy, France aimed to encourage “present non secular, ethnic, and regional variations inside Syria”. These divisions included the 1920 creation of Better Lebanon as a mandate separate from Syria. France ensured that the biggest non secular group inside newly created Lebanon was the Maronite Christians.

Why did the Syrian struggle begin?

The unrest in Syria, which started on 15 March 2011 as a part of the broader 2011 Arab Spring protests, grew out of discontent with the Syrian authorities and escalated to an armed battle after protests calling for Assad’s removing had been violently suppressed.

Are you able to drink alcohol in Syria?

Alcohol in Syria isn’t banned as it’s in some Muslim international locations. Neither is it reserved for the higher class elite or non secular minorities. Syria, Lebanon and Iraq have lengthy produced their very own alcoholic drinks, from beer to wine to the anise-based arak
